Is Greensboro or Zebulon Safer?
According to crimebycity.com's analysis of 2024 FBI data, Zebulon is safer than Greensboro (Safety Score 23/100 vs 6/100), with a total crime rate of 2,781 per 100,000 versus 4,307 for Greensboro — 35% lower. Greensboro has higher rates in 0 of 7 crime categories.
The biggest difference is in violent crime, where Zebulon has a 64% lower rate.
Note: Greensboro is 29.4x larger by coverage, which can affect crime rate comparisons. Larger cities tend to report higher rates due to density and more comprehensive reporting.

Detailed Crime Rate Comparison
| Crime Type | Greensboro | Zebulon |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Crime Rate | 4,306.9 | 2,781.0 | +1,525.9 |
| Violent Crime Rate | 923.7 | 328.3 | +595.4 |
| Murder Rate | 14.1 | 9.7 | +4.5 |
| Rape Rate | 26.3 | 0.0 | +26.3 |
| Robbery Rate | 173.5 | 67.6 | +105.9 |
| Aggravated Assault Rate | 709.8 | 251.1 | +458.8 |
| Property Crime Rate | 3,383.1 | 2,452.7 | +930.4 |
| Burglary Rate | 482.4 | 366.9 | +115.5 |
| Larceny-Theft Rate | 2,308.2 | 1,854.0 | +454.2 |
| Motor Vehicle Theft Rate | 592.5 | 231.8 | +360.8 |
All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R 2024.

About Greensboro, NC
Greensboro, a city in North Carolina's Piedmont Triad, was the site of the 1960 Woolworth's lunch counter sit-in. It's a diverse community with a population of over 299,000 residents. With a safety score of 6/100 and a population coverage of 304,306, Greensboro has a total crime rate of 4,306.9 per 100,000 residents.
About Zebulon, NC
Zebulon, a small town in eastern Wake County, is known for its annual "Mud Day" festival. It sits at the intersection of US-264 and NC-39, a historically agricultural community transitioning with suburban growth. With a safety score of 23/100 and a population coverage of 10,356, Zebulon has a total crime rate of 2,781.0 per 100,000 residents.
